Ranbir Kapoor is Nissan’s brand Ambassador.
Nissan Motors India has roped in Bollywood heartthrob Ranbir Kapoor as its brand ambassador for the Micra.
The first deliveries will commence in July. With the appointment of Kapoor, Nissan becomes the second Japanese car major to appoint a brand ambassador after Toyota Kirloskar Motor which roped in Aamir Khan for the Innova. Previous brand ambassadors in the passenger car segment include Sachin Tendulkar for the Palio and Shah Rukh Khan for the Santro.
